The Power Of Vision
One of the most important lessons from leadership speakers is the significance of vision. A leader who does not have a clear direction cannot inspire others to follow. Vision is the foundation of transformation because it gives teams something meaningful to work toward. A speaker frequently reminds audiences that having a compelling future vision involves more than just establishing objectives. When leaders communicate vision with clarity and passion, they motivate others to align their energy with a shared purpose.
Embracing Change With Confidence
Transformation requires change, and change is often uncomfortable. Many people resist it because it threatens their sense of stability. Leadership speakers highlight the importance of embracing change with confidence. They teach that leaders must be the first to model adaptability. By approaching uncertainty with openness and positivity, leaders set the tone for their teams. Instead of fearing disruption, they frame it as an opportunity for innovation and growth. This perspective shifts organizations from a culture of resistance to one of resilience.
Building Trust And Authenticity
True transformation cannot happen without trust. Leadership speakers often stress that leaders must be authentic if they want to inspire others. Being sincere, open, and consistent in both words and deeds is what it means to be authentic; perfection is not the goal. Leaders who admit mistakes, listen actively, and show empathy are more likely to earn trust. Transformation is made possible once trust is built because individuals feel comfortable taking chances, exchanging ideas, and giving their all to the journey ahead.
Inspiring Through Storytelling
Stories have the power to move hearts and minds in ways that data and instructions cannot. A leadership speaker often relies on storytelling to convey lessons of transformation. Through stories of personal experiences, historical events, or real-world examples, they make abstract ideas relatable and memorable. Leaders who learn to tell meaningful stories can connect with their teams on a deeper level. Storytelling inspires belief, and belief is what drives lasting transformation.
Cultivating Emotional Intelligence
Another central lesson is the role of emotional intelligence in leadership. Leaders are more capable of directing change when they are able to identify and control their own emotions as well as those of others. A leadership speaker often emphasizes self-awareness, empathy, and communication as essential skills. Emotional intelligence helps leaders create environments where people feel valued and supported. It turns leadership from a position of authority into a relationship built on respect and understanding.
The Courage To Take Action
Transformation is more than ideas and inspiration; it is about the courage to act. Leadership speakers challenge their audiences to move beyond comfort zones. They remind us that no great achievement is possible without risk. Leaders need to be prepared to attempt new things, make difficult choices, and acknowledge that failure is a possibility. Courage does not mean fearlessness; it means choosing to act despite fear. When leaders demonstrate courage, they encourage others to do the same, building momentum for change.
Fostering A Culture Of Growth
Finally, leadership speakers stress that transformation is not a single event but an ongoing process. For transformation to take root, leaders must foster a culture of growth. Promoting lifelong learning, acknowledging accomplishments, and giving people the chance to gain new skills are all part of this. Growth-oriented cultures empower individuals to push boundaries and explore possibilities. When growth becomes part of the organizational identity, transformation becomes sustainable and long-lasting.
